Architecture of software project

Software architecture the difference between architecture and. Software architecture refers to the fundamental structures of a software system and the discipline of creating such structures and systems. Because project reporting is fully integrated with your firms. Weve designed monograph to make it easier to do what needs to get done in order to deliver. Structural engineering software the vitruvius project. You need a system that unifies budgeting, project planningexecution, team communication. Chief architect software brings home design projects to life. Monograph was founded by former architectural designers and project managers who experienced the pain of working with outofdate solutions with poor support. You will learn how to express and document the design and architecture of a software system using a visual notation. Software components essential project documentation.

In simple words, software architecture is the process of converting software characteristics such as flexibility, scalability, feasibility, reusability, and security into a structured solution that meets the technical and the business expectations. Practical tips on software architecture design, part one medium. Autocad architecture toolset architectural design software. Easy projects is a powerful project management tool that helps architectural firms organize and coordinate team members tasks and. Jul 27, 2017 with that, our search for the best project management software for architects begins.

By the end of this tutorial, the readers will develop a sound understanding of. The essential project ea tool for enterprise architects try either our open source or one of our commercial versions of our awardwinning enterprise architecture tool, built by architects for. Software architecture the difference between architecture. The search for the best project management software for architects. It functions as a blueprint for the system and the developing project, laying out the tasks. The industry requires a high level of precision, full legal compliance, and strict. Project management software for architects and designers. I started off by looking on quora, but the results were out of date or consisted of someone trying to promote their own upstart project management software.

By utilizing software architecture when managing projects, practitioners experience better success completing projects on time and within budget, while effectively fulfilling the project s requirements. Bigtime gives you the tools you need to deliver billable work on time and on budget, giving. Feb 05, 2019 ensuring productivity and growth is essential for architecture and engineering teams. Architecture accounting software is accounting software that allows firms to track time spent working on multiple projects, manage expenses and budgets and accurately bill customers for their work.

Defining a final architecture or project plan in that development phase is a rather bold venture. Software components can be captured at a very coarse grain e. What is the difference between software architecture and software design. The software architecture of a program or computing system is a depiction of the. The best way to plan new programs is to study them and understand. There is a plethora of quality solutions in this niche.

Top 10 architectural design software for budding architects. The industry requires a high level of precision, full legal compliance, and strict adherence to deadlines. Instead of lines and circles, you can use actual walls, roofs, beams, columns and other building components and also realworld characteristics of the physical building such as windows and. If you are unable to provide a high level overview of the architecture of your project, or explain the project in 5 minutes let alone 15 to somebody else, then most likely the reason is that you are. Architecture software software for architects autodesk. Software design refers to the smaller structures and it deals with the internal design of a single software process. In this video, i talk about the two similar but distinct roles in a software project, and make it clear what the. Which is why you should consider investing in architecture accounting softwareaccounting platforms with additional functionality for things like project management, time tracking, billing. In the software design and architecture specialization, you will learn how to apply design principles, patterns, and architectures to create reusable and flexible software applications and. Architecture software is used by architects, civil engineers and others to create drawings and blueprints for structures.

Were committed to providing the best product in the industry. The forethought of our design was to create, build and deliver a faster and easier workflow for your everyday project tasks, but even more importantly, deliver a more reliable program than anything. Rights to install, access, or otherwise use autodesk software and services including. If youre an architect or design project manager, this allinone software will help you prioritise from lead to quote to invoice. The software architecture of a program or computing system is a depiction of the system that aids in understanding how the system will behave. Architecture centered software project planning acspp is an important software development methodology for planning software projects. Additionally, you can also use architectural software to look at workflows and project management tasks, some. Using architecture project management software has been invaluable for boosting employee productivity across the board.

It provides main features like email integration, task management, time tracking and more. The essential project enterprise architecture tool. Architectural accounting software tracks costs by individual job and records client information. The easiest way to create a software architecture diagram is editing an existing template. Architecture project management software provides many general project management features such as project scheduling, task management, timesheet tracking, and document management, that are designed for the specific needs of an architecture firm. This is the initial phase within the software development life cycle sdlcshifting the concentration from the problem to the solution. The best project management software for architects. This page presents a wellcreated software architecture diagram example and other architecture diagrams created by edraw. You need to get some distance, so you can see your own work as others would see it. Project management software for architects bqe core.

Requirements of the software should be transformed into an architecture that describes the softwares toplevel structure and identifies its components. Redbracket hub is an architecture design software that provides indepth features and functionality to architects and engineers. This software architecture template can save many hours in creating great software. This is the initial phase within the software development life cycle sdlc shifting the concentration from the problem to the solution. Project architecture support, from project inception to completion, ensuring that solutions are being correctly implemented and augmenting the team if necessary. Both a project management system and accounting tool built specifically for architects and engineers, deltek ajera offers a twoinone solution for firms that may be looking. Easy projects is a powerful project management tool that helps architectural firms organize and coordinate team members tasks and deliverables, while allowing clients realtime access to project updates. In addition, they might not be aware of the best approach to take when designing certain aspects of the application. The challenge i usually face is, a poor architecture leads an application to worst way, initially it looks good to use repository pattern, unitofwork, singleton, factory, ioc and so on but, later on it becomes unmanageable. This is where a reference architecture can be the most valuable. Autodesk makes software and services available on a licensed or subscription basis. Architecturecentered software project planning acspp is an important software development methodology for planning software projects. Core began as a solution for architects and engineers our founder and key leaders wanted a better system for their own businesses.

The essential project ea tool for enterprise architects try either our open source or one of our commercial versions of our awardwinning enterprise architecture tool, built by architects for architects. Architectural consulting firms need more than just a timesheet. Chief architect software is the professional tool of choice for architects, home builders, remodelers, and interior designers. The best 3d architecture bim software many are free all3dp. The project team can harvest not only tool and language choices, but also design. Now, after defining the previous characteristics the business owner tells you that they have a limited budget for that project, another characteristic comes up here. Practice management software for architects workflowmax.

Software architecture serves as the blueprint for both the system and the project developing it, defining the work assignments that must be carried out by design and implementation teams. List of top us based architect software for small businesses. Lack of understanding of the role of software architect and poor. This makes it hard to make informed comparisons to select the best architecture software for your requirements.

A second common style of definition for architecture is that it its the design decisions that need to be made early in a project, but ralph. Software architecture software engineering institute. Before major software development starts, we have to choose a suitable architecture that will. Many times projects spend an inordinate amount of time exploring tool options. Free architecture project management solutions on the market are going to be generic and wont include features that most architecture firms look for like time management. Best architecture software for architects experts choose. Actcad is a virtual architecture software for architects and civil engineers. With that, our search for the best project management software for architects begins.

This project management tool can be used by startups, enterprises, smes. Architecture software is project management and computeraided design cad program that enables contractors, engineers, and architects to digitally create and refine highquality architectural designs and manage their projects and job proposals. Dozens of examples will give you an instant headstart. Software engineering architectural design geeksforgeeks. Ensuring productivity and growth is essential for architecture and engineering teams. With integrated project and financial management tools in place, your firm will be bestpositioned to deliver inspiring designs, price accurately and realise profitable margins. Mark richards is a bostonbased software architect whos been thinking for more than 30 years about how data should flow through software. The software needs the architectural design to represents the. Architecture software is also known as construction design software and architectural drawing software. The architecture of a software system is a metaphor, analogous to the architecture of a. Best project management software for architects our picks. Both a project management system and accounting tool built specifically for architects and engineers, deltek ajera offers a twoinone solution for firms that may be looking for a fully integrated product to replace both excel and current accounting software.

Rights to install, access, or otherwise use autodesk software and services including free software or services are limited to license rights and services entitlements expressly granted by autodesk in the applicable license or service agreement and are subject to acceptance of and compliance. Oct, 2015 what is the difference between software architecture and software design. This is accomplished through architectural design also called system design, which acts as a preliminary blueprint from which software can be developed. Wrike is a project management software for architecture industry. Additionally, you can also use architectural software to look at workflows and project management tasks, some of which are included, integrated, or can simply be exported into another program. Architecture project management software helps firms manage income and expenses for each project. Choose a floor plan template that is most similar to your design and customize it quickly and easily. Ever wondered how large enterprise scale systems are designed.

The architecture of a software system is a metaphor, analogous to the architecture of a building. Software architecture design and modeling, to prioritize the projects architectural drivers and improve definition of it strategies for greater predictability and reduced risk. Architect project management software tool workzone. Requirements of the software should be transformed into an architecture that describes the software s toplevel structure and identifies its components. Revit is the allinone software for 2d and 3d projects, that produces a total project output including modeling, rendering, and 2d construction documents. By the end of this tutorial, the readers will develop a sound understanding of the concepts of software architecture and design concepts and will be in a position to choose and follow the right model for a given software project. Project management software for architects monograph. The modelviewcontroller mvc structure, which is the standard software development approach offered by most of the popular web frameworks, is clearly a. Difference between software architecture and software design. If youre an architect or design project manager, this allinone software will help you prioritise from lead to quote to invoice and everything in between. How do you answer explain current architecture of your. Additionally, you can also use architectural software to look at workflows and project management tasks, some of.

In this video, i talk about the two similar but distinct roles in a software project, and make it clear what. Implementing 2d and 3d architecture software allows designers to draft at greater speed, test ideas, and determine consistent project workflows. Top reasons smartdraw is the best architecture software. Project management software for architecture easy projects. If you are unable to provide a high level overview of the architecture of your project, or explain the project in 5 minutes let alone 15 to somebody else, then most likely the reason is that you are too close to the coalface. It provides a robust set of drawing features such as 2d drawing, 3d modeling, architectural symbol library, design templates, drafting, color filling, and more. Workzone architect project management software helps teams stay organized and get more work done. Jul 27, 2018 the definition of software architecture. There are industryspecific project management solutions that offer free demos for a limited time. Mar 12, 2014 but i am involved in software development mostly web applications. Lack of awareness of the importance of architectural design to software development. Best project management software for architects 2020. With the evolution of technology and the architecture industry, architectural software has changed the way architects plan and design buildings.

987 1051 1524 813 1477 1013 1352 871 174 1011 1178 1362 1503 1140 1028 1000 1244 755 742 1248 1346 270 391 1330 1539 1023 204 1221 207 1427 489 499 1489 900 95 877 964 256 961 956 1243 1464 540 1168 698 1495 410 636